Aldair vs Aldric

American parents have registered 1,454 Aldairs since 1880, against 538 Aldrics. Aldair is still ahead, with 26 babies in 2025.

Which name is older

Half of the Aldrics alive today are over 23; half the Aldairs are over 19. That is 4 years between them: two names in use at the same time, worn by two different generations.
